Dailekh
Vehicular movement along the Karnali Highway has been obstructed once again following a landslide at Paduka River in Chamunda Bindrasaini Municipality, Dailekh.
As a result, hundreds of vehicles have been stranded on the midway.
According to the District Police Office, efforts are underway to clear the landslide debris.
